Factors Affecting Temperature Resistance
The temperature resistance of epoxy glass mat is primarily determined by the type of epoxy resin used, the glass fiber reinforcement, and the manufacturing process. Let's take a closer look at each of these factors:
Epoxy Resin
Epoxy resins are thermosetting polymers that undergo a chemical reaction when cured, forming a three-dimensional network structure. The chemical composition of the epoxy resin significantly influences its temperature resistance. Different types of epoxy resins have different glass transition temperatures (Tg), which is the temperature at which the resin changes from a hard, glassy state to a soft, rubbery state. Epoxy resins with higher Tg values generally exhibit better temperature resistance.
For example, some high-performance epoxy resins can have Tg values above 200°C, making them suitable for applications requiring high-temperature stability. On the other hand, standard epoxy resins typically have Tg values in the range of 80-120°C, which may be sufficient for many general-purpose applications.
Glass Fiber Reinforcement
The glass fiber reinforcement in epoxy glass mat provides mechanical strength and stiffness to the composite material. The type and quality of the glass fiber can also affect the temperature resistance of the epoxy glass mat. Glass fibers have high melting points and excellent thermal stability, which helps to maintain the structural integrity of the composite at elevated temperatures.
E-glass fibers are the most commonly used type of glass fiber in epoxy glass mat due to their good mechanical properties and relatively low cost. S-glass fibers, on the other hand, have higher strength and stiffness than E-glass fibers and can provide better temperature resistance in applications where high mechanical performance is required at elevated temperatures.
Manufacturing Process
The manufacturing process of epoxy glass mat can also impact its temperature resistance. Proper curing of the epoxy resin is essential to ensure the formation of a strong and stable network structure. Incomplete curing can result in a lower Tg value and reduced temperature resistance.
Additionally, the quality of the manufacturing process can affect the distribution of the glass fibers in the epoxy matrix. A uniform distribution of glass fibers helps to improve the mechanical properties and temperature resistance of the epoxy glass mat.
